Seiji Ueda is a scholar working on Nephrology, Clinical Biochemistry and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Seiji Ueda has authored 90 papers receiving a total of 4.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Nephrology, 33 papers in Clinical Biochemistry and 23 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Seiji Ueda’s work include Advanced Glycation End Products research (30 papers), Chronic Kidney Disease and Diabetes (22 papers) and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(15 papers). Seiji Ueda is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Glycation End Products research (30 papers), Chronic Kidney Disease and Diabetes (22 papers) and Nitric Oxide and Endothelin Effects (15 papers). Seiji Ueda coll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Germany. Seiji Ueda's co-authors include Seiya Okuda, Sho‐ichi Yamagishi, Tsutomu Imaizumi, Kei Fukami, Hidehiro Matsuoka, Hiroshi Miyazaki, Michiaki Usui, Takanori Matsui, Masayoshi Takeuchi and John P. Cooke and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and Circulation Research.
